Hi everyone! My big male, Dash, burned his shell this winter on a heat lamp. I have kept it clean and disinfected, and aside from enjoying it being scratched, he's as normal (and frisky) as ever. I just checked on him and that burned scute at the top is getting more loose. Will this fall off? Underneath its just white shell. Should I be concerned?

Over time new keratin is growing under the dead bone (white stuff). It takes a VERY long time for it to take over the area, but eventually that old, dead bone, with the new keratin under it, will pop off and he will be his pretty self once again. I've only seen this in box turtles, and it took over a year to happen.

Yikes. I believe what is left under the scute is just osteiod, or bone. I would take exceptional care to prevent further damage to this area from bacterial, UV or mechanical means. The keratin scute provides a boundary layer of protection from the elements and your tortoise is much more vulnerable to infection there. As Yvonne said, with time keratin will again build up and 'regrow' the missing scute.
